Too Much water Pressure
Strange thing happened today we were out on the 35 and the water pressure guage was pegged at 35 psi at anything over 2200 Rpms I was thinking thermostat restriction any suggestions

T-stat housing design. Not big enough internal bypass circut.
I had same problem, so broke down and installed the Merc relief valve setup. Kinda pricey, but now my pressure is maxed at 19-20.
